Job description
Overview

We are seeking to appoint a highly motivated, qualified and experienced individual to assist in the delivery of a comprehensive sporting programme for students, staff and the local community in order to help maximise the use of sports resources at the University.

Responsibilities

With a focus on excellent customer service, your role will be to ensure all Sports Centre facilities are fit for purpose, setting up equipment as required and ensuring all areas are clean, tidy and ready for use. You will undertake fitness inductions and give basic advice on safe technique and training programmes, ensuring that gym users behave in an appropriate and safe manner in line with Normal Operating Procedures. You will use our leisure management system on a daily basis and ensure that equipment maintenance records are up to date and accurate, reporting any issues to the Facilities & Operations Manager. You will have responsibility for supervising casual staff and will be expected to deputise for the Facilities & Operations Manager when required. You will have responsibility for ensuring that the building is ready for opening and is closed down properly each night in accordance with our Normal Operating Procedures.

You will hold a REPS accredited level 2 fitness qualification (or equivalent) and have knowledge of a broad range of sports and their requirements. You should also have experience of working with young adults and children and assisting with sports events. Please note that we will consider applicants who do not currently hold a level 2 fitness qualification but who would be willing to make a commitment to gaining the qualification within the first 6 months of their employment.

You must possess excellent communication skills, the ability to develop good working relationships with people at all levels, and good organisational and time management skills. It will be necessary for the post holder to work on a rotating shift pattern including weekends, evenings and public holidays as required. A flexible approach to working hours is required, particularly during University term time.
